A unique opportunity to enter one of the most important restoration sites underway in Rome: that of the Monumental Halls on the first floor of Palazzo Venezia, namely Sala del Mappamondo, Sala delle Battaglie, and Sala Regia, built by Pope Paul II during the Renaissance and the theater over the centuries of historical and cultural events of great importance, in some cases truly extraordinary. You will be able to climb the scaffolding, see the decorations of the ceilings and walls up close, and learn from the living voice of the restorers the phenomena of degradation that threaten them and the solutions put in place to stop them, from the consolidation of the support to the cleaning of the surfaces up to the reintegration of the gaps.
